Ok, so I am kinda all over the place with what I want to do in the military and which branch. I will be done with my degree in Computing and Security Technology concentration in Security in September of 2008. I know the Navy just started the CTN rating so it is kinda young and the Air Force has had some network defense jobs for awhile, but the Cyber Warfare Command is new. So which would be best to start an information security career in the military? Thanks in advance!

Well, I would say go Air Force, but, unlike the Navy, they don't have a designator dedicated solely to INFOSEC or CNO. Their training programs are much more developed though.

The Navy is still a bit behind in getting the training pipeline for CTN nailed down.
